| Parameter | Specification |
|---|---|
| Appearance | White to off-white crystalline powder |
| CAS Number | 79-07-2 |
| Molecular Formula | C2H4ClNO |
| Molecular Weight | 93.512 |
| Melting Point | 116-118 °C |
| Assay (HPLC) | ≥99.0% |
| Moisture Content | ≤0.2% |
Industrial Applications
The primary application of 2-Chloroacetamide lies in the synthesis of antihistaminic agents, most notably as a key intermediate in the production of Cetirizine hydrochloride. The high purity levels achieved in our manufacturing process minimize impurities that could affect the safety profile of the final drug product. Beyond pharmaceuticals, this compound finds utility in various organic synthesis pathways where chloroacetyl functionality is required for further derivatization.
